How to Make Creamy Cinnamon Roll Cheesecake with Swirled Cinnamon Sugar
Creating this Creamy Cinnamon Roll Cheesecake is a delightful journey. Follow these simple steps, and you’ll be rewarded with a dessert that’s as beautiful as it is delicious. Let’s get started!
Step 1: Preheat and Prepare
First things first, preheat your oven to 325°F (163°C). This ensures your cheesecake bakes evenly. While that’s heating up, grab a 9-inch springform pan. Grease it well and wrap the outside with aluminum foil. This step is crucial! It prevents water from seeping in during baking, keeping your cheesecake perfectly creamy.
Step 2: Make the Crust
In a medium bowl, combine your gra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and sugar. Mix until everything is well combined. The mixture should resemble wet sand. Now, press it firmly into the bottom of your prepared springform pan. This crust will provide a sweet, crunchy base for your cheesecake.
Step 3: Prepare the Cheesecake Filling
In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ese with an electric mixer until it’s smooth and creamy. Gradually add in the granulated sugar and vanilla extract, mixing until fully incorporated. Remember, don’t overmix! We want a light texture, not a dense one.
Step 4: Add Eggs and Sour Cream
Now, it’s time to add the eggs. Do this one at a time, mixing on low speed after each addition. This helps keep the batter light and fluffy. Once all the eggs are in, stir in the sour cream until the mixture is smooth. This adds that extra creaminess we all love!
Step 5: Create the Cinnamon Sugar Mixture
In a small bowl, mix together the ground cinnamon and brown sugar. This will be your swirled topping, adding that signature cinnamon roll flavor. The combination of these two ingredients is what makes this cheesecake truly special.
Step 6: Layer the Cheesecake
Pour half of the cheesecake batter over the crust in the springform pan. Then, sprinkle half of the cinnamon sugar mixture over the batter. Pour the remaining cheesecake batter on top, followed by the rest of the cinnamon sugar. Use a knife to gently swirl the cinnamon sugar into the batter, creating a beautiful marbled effect.
Step 7: Bake in a Water Bath
Place your springform pan in a larger baking dish. Fill the dish with hot water until it reaches halfway up the sides of the springform pan. This water bath method is key! It helps the cheesecake bake evenly and prevents cracks.
Step 8: Cool and Chill
After baking for 55-65 minutes, the edges should be set, and the center slightly jiggly. Turn off the oven and crack the door open, allowing the cheesecake to cool in the oven for about an hour. Once cooled, remove it from the water bath and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, preferably overnight. This chilling time is essential for the flavors to meld and the cheesecake to set perfectly.

Tips for Success
- Make sure your cream cheese is at room temperature for easy mixing.
- Don’t skip the water bath; it’s crucial for a smooth, crack-free cheesecake.
- Use a gentle hand when swirling the cinnamon sugar to avoid overmixing.
- Let the cheesecake cool gradually in the oven to prevent sudden temperature changes.
- For best flavor, chill the cheesecake overnight before serving.

FAQs about Creamy Cinnamon Roll Cheesecake with Swirled Cinnamon Sugar
Can I make this cheesecake ahead of time?
Absolutely! In fact, making the Creamy Cinnamon Roll Cheesecake a day in advance allows the flavors to meld beautifully. Just be sure to refrigerate it overnight for the best results.
How do I know when the cheesecake is done baking?
The edges should be set, while the center remains slightly jiggly. It will firm up as it cools. Remember, a water bath helps prevent cracks and ensures even baking!
Can I freeze the cheesecake?
Yes, you can freeze this cheesecake!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il. It can be frozen for up to three months. Just thaw it in the fridge before serving.
What can I use instead of sour cream?
If you don’t have sour cream on hand, Greek yogurt is a great substitute. It will still provide that creamy texture and tangy flavor.
How can I make this cheesecake less sweet?
To reduce the sweetness, you can cut back on the granulated sugar in the filling or use a sugar substitute. Just keep in mind that it may alter the texture slightly.

PrintCreamy Cinnamon Roll Cheesecake with Swirled Cinnamon Sugar: Discover the Secret to Perfectly Layered Flavor!
- Total Time: 5 hours 30 minutes (including chilling time)
- Yield: 12 servings
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
A deliciously creamy cheesecake infused with the flavors of cinnamon rolls, featuring a swirled cinnamon sugar topping.
Ingredients
- 2 cups graham cracker crumbs
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
- 4 (8-ounce) packages c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 4 large eggs
- 1/2 cup sour cream
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 325°F (163°C). Grease a 9-inch springform pan and wrap the outside with aluminum foil to prevent water from seeping in during baking.
- In a medium bowl, combine gra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and 2 tablespoons of granulated sugar. Mix until well combined. Press the mixture firmly into the bottom of the prepared springform pan to form the crust.
- In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ese with an electric mixer until smooth and creamy. Gradually add 1 cup of granulated sugar and vanilla extract, mixing until fully incorporated.
- Add the eggs, one at a time, mixing on low speed after each addition until just combined. Do not overmix.
- Stir in the sour cream until smooth.
- In a small bowl, mix together the ground cinnamon and brown sugar.
- Pour half of the cheesecake batter over the crust in the springform pan. Sprinkle half of the cinnamon sugar mixture over the batter. Pour the remaining cheesecake batter on top, then sprinkle the rest of the cinnamon sugar mixture. Use a knife to gently swirl the cinnamon sugar into the batter for a marbled effect.
- Place the springform pan in a larger baking dish and fill the dish with hot water until it reaches halfway up the sides of the springform pan (this creates a water bath).
- Bake for 55-65 minutes, or until the edges are set and the center is slightly jiggly. Turn off the oven and crack the door open, allowing the cheesecake to cool in the oven for 1 hour.
- Remove the cheesecake from the water bath and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, preferably overnight, before serving.
